Our client, a market leading property consultancy in the UK, is looking to recruit several experienced members into their Residential Valuations team. As a company, they provide market leading advice to fund managers, developers, property companies, and banks, aiming to deliver the best service at all times.
Reporting directly to the Senior Director, the role will assist a specialist team in providing valuations for loan security, investment, and strategic advice to a broad range of clients across the residential sector. You will be covering the following in your role:
- Close liaison with clients ensuring high quality advice is consistently delivered.
- Preparation of valuation of a broad range of asset types across the residential sector in the UK, including development sites, investment portfolios, and high value properties in Central London.
- Preparation of valuation reports for a broad range of purposes including accounts, loan security, and strategic advice.
- Working closely with senior team members on high profile instructions.
- Support an expanding team in its business development objectives and continued growth in revenue.
You should have strong knowledge of the following:
- Development appraisals
- Party Wall Awards
- Project management
- Mortgage valuations
- Red Book Valuations for residential property
- RICS Level 2 Surveys
- RICS Level 3 Surveys
- Disrepair Surveys
To be successful you will need to meet the following requirements:
- RICS qualified or equivalent (open to discussion)
- Minimum of two years’ post-qualification experience and experience of carrying out Level 1, 2, and 3 residential surveys for private clients and/or lending institutions
- Experience using tablet technology for site note taking and familiarity with Quest software, GoReport, RightMove Surveyor Comparable tool, and Building Cost Information Service (BCIS) reinstatement valuation.
- Organised, focused, and high attention to detail.
- Team player who deals effectively with colleagues and clients.
- Ability to work in a fast-paced dynamic environment.
- Passionate about the residential sector.
- Residential experience preferable but not essential.
- Valid UK driving licence.
- Willing to work remotely/travel when necessary and work on own initiative.
